Implementing Risk-Based Sourcing for Enhanced Supply Chain Resilience
In today's volatile global marketplace, supply chain resilience is paramount. Organizations are increasingly recognizing the need to mitigate risks and build more robust supply chains. A key strategy in achieving this goal is adopting a risk-based sourcing approach. This involves proactively evaluating potential risks across the entire supply chain, from raw materials to finished goods, and then developing sourcing strategies that minimize these threats. By carefully evaluating supplier capabilities, geographical dependencies, and potential disruptions, companies can create a more resilient supply chain that is better equipped to absorb unforeseen events.
